Molecular Biology Enzymes, Kits & Reagents Market Size and Share Forecast Outlook From 2025 to 2035

The global Molecular Biology Enzymes, Kits & Reagents Market is estimated to be valued at USD 25,900.5 million in 2025 and is projected to reach USD 64,187.5 million by 2035, registering a CAGR of 9.5% over the forecast period.

The market is driven by rising demand for advanced research tools supporting genomic, transcriptomic, and proteomic studies. An expanding pipeline of precision medicine and biologics development has fueled increased consumption of high-quality reagents and kits designed to deliver reproducible results across diverse laboratory workflows.

Pharmaceutical companies, biotechnology firms, and academic research institutions have continued to prioritize investments in next-generation sequencing, PCR, and cloning applications to accelerate discovery timelines and enhance data reliability. Manufacturers have focused on automation-ready products and reagent formulations compatible with high-throughput platforms, which has enabled laboratories to scale operations efficiently.

Challenges and Opportunities

Challenge

Price Sensitivity and Reproducibility Concerns

The molecular biology enzymes, kits, and reagents market faces challenges stemming from high product costs, batch-to-batch variability, and the need for ultra-reliable performance in sensitive assays. Academic laboratories and emerging biotech firms are often considered to be under budget constraints and thus price sensitive and wary to adopt premium products. Uncertain performance of reagents or master mixes for particularly in PCR, cloning, and sequencing workflows can put into question the reproducibility of experiments.

The procurement challenge is further exacerbated by the absence of universal standards and differences in formulation across suppliers. Such issues prompt distrust among users, especially during high-throughput applications, and hinder general acceptance in developing markets where support infrastructure is limited.

Opportunity

Genomics Boom and Growth in Personalized Medicine

Despite all the pricing issues, the molecular biology enzymes, kits, and reagents market seems to be booming owing to considerably higher global investments in genomics, diagnostics, and personalized medicine.

These products are central to flows in next-generation sequencing (NGS), CRISPR editing, liquid biopsy, and molecular diagnostics. Technology advancement-hot-start polymerases, high-fidelity enzymes, lyophilized reagents-increases efficiency, sensitivity, and shelf stability.

Along with this, the decentralization of molecular testing and laboratories has increased the demand for easy-to-use, pre-validated kits. Increased validation and acceptance of precision health have fueled the dual market for reagent and enzyme suppliers: for high-throughput platforms and for small-scale research laboratories worldwide.

Country-Wise Outlook

United States

Highly superior growth of the USA market for molecular biology enzymes, kits, and reagents can be attributed to advancement in genomic research, increased use of molecular diagnostics, and high-throughput sequencing. The major school consuming PCR kits, ligases, restriction enzymes, and reverse transcriptases includes academic laboratories, biotechs, and clinical research organizations.

Companies based in the USA are virtually engaged in innovating formulations of enzymes for high fidelity, sensitivity, and multiplex compatibility through concerted, strong NIH and private funding.

Country CAGR (2025 to 2035)
USA 9.3%

United Kingdom

The market in the United Kingdom is showing strong growth fuelled by government-funded genomic medicine initiatives, university research, and a growing cluster of biotech companies. It is to a wide extent used in diagnostics development, synthetic biology, and biomarker discovery.

High-efficiency enzymes and ready-to-use reagent kits by UK suppliers will have the effect of streamlining laboratory workflows while increasing reproducibility in both academic and commercial R&D environments.

Country CAGR (2025 to 2035)
UK 9.1%

European Union

The European Union is key for molecular biology enzymes, kits, and reagents, especially Germany, France, and the Netherlands. EU-based companies and research institutes generate demand in genomics, personalized medicine, and infectious disease testing.

The region invests next in generation sequencing reagents, enzyme cocktails for CRISPR workflow, and ultra-pure reagents for qPCR and RT-PCR applications supported by Horizon Europe and other R&D funding programs.

Region CAGR (2025 to 2035)
European Union 9.5%

Japan

With their precision medicine initiatives in translational research and with the new technologies for automating molecular testing, Japan seems to be slowly growing. The majority users now of nucleic acid amplification kits, polymerases, and cloning reagents are the Japanese biotech firms and academic labs.

Thermostability, hot-start functionalities, and very low inhibitor sensitivity are today's advances of local manufacturers in enzyme formulations in line with the increasing demand outside their clinical laboratories and the pharmaceutical research development.

Country CAGR (2025 to 2035)
Japan 9.2%

South Korea

The South Korean economy continues strong growth due to the closure of the molecular biology enzymes kits and reagents market government funding, biotech expansion, and inclination to localise reagent manufacture. The genomics and diagnostic industries within the country are going through considerable growth, especially in cancer research and infectious disease detection.

South Korean firms put up investments in developing recombinant enzymes and pre-packaged reagent kits in order to boost local supply chains and meet export demand across Southeast Asia.

Country CAGR (2025 to 2035)
South Korea 10.0%

Competition Outlook

Competition in the molecular biology enzymes, kits, and reagents market has intensified as manufacturers invest in innovation, automation compatibility, and regulatory-compliant product lines. Leading suppliers have focused on expanding reagent portfolios with high-fidelity enzymes and proprietary formulations designed to improve reaction efficiency and reproducibility. Strategic collaborations have been pursued with technology companies to integrate reagents into next-generation sequencing and digital PCR platforms.

Training and certification programs have been launched to support end users in optimizing workflows and ensuring regulatory compliance. Geographic expansion initiatives have targeted emerging markets to increase customer reach and diversify revenue streams. These activities are expected to reinforce market leadership and drive differentiation as research demands accelerate.

Key Development:

  • In 2024, New England Biolabs® Launches NEBNext® Enzymatic 5hmC-seq Kit, a novel enzyme-based method for the specific detection of 5hmC sites.
  • In 2024, Codexis, Inc. a leading enzyme engineering company, today announced it has entered into a non-exclusive commercial and manufacturing license agreement with Alphazyme LLC, for multiple enzymes in Codexis’ life science enzyme portfolio.
